Edtech.com's Summary

Colorado State University is hiring a GIS Information Systems (GIS) Specialist. The specialist will administer a large-scale ArcGIS Hub Premium site, develop and maintain GIS tools and workflows, support spatial data integrity, and ensure compliance with federal infrastructure and environmental standards. The role involves collaborating with interdisciplinary teams and managing data collection and web applications using the Esri ArcGIS suite.

Highlights
  • Administer and maintain ArcGIS Hub Premium site and related applications like Dashboards and Experience Builder.
  • Design, develop, and manage data workflows including ArcGIS Online feature services and mobile data collection tools (Field Maps, Smart Forms, Survey123).
  • Support data organization, metadata standards, and spatial data integrity according to Department of Defense and federal standards.
  • Collaborate with cross-functional teams to define GIS requirements and troubleshoot GIS tool performance.
  • Required skills include ArcGIS Pro 3.x, ArcGIS Online, configuring web/mobile GIS applications, coordinate systems, and spatial data transformations.
  • Required qualifications: B.S./B.A. in Geography, GIS, Ecology/Biology, Natural Resources Management or related field; minimum 3 years professional GIS experience; valid driver’s license; able to obtain Department of Defense clearance.
  • Preferred qualifications include M.S. degree, 5+ years GIS experience, ArcGIS Hub Premium administration, workflow management software, programming languages like Python or Arcade, and knowledge of DoD GIS standards.
  • Physical requirement: ability to lift 25 pounds and traverse uneven terrain.
  • Compensation ranges from $60,000 to $85,000 annually with a full benefits package.
  • Position involves supporting a large-scale Air Force survey, infrastructure, and deployment program under Colorado State University’s Center for Environmental Management of Military Lands (CEMML).
